I have a 120mm Radiator with a 105cfm fan on it. it works fine but the fan is around 40db I was thinking of using two silent fans one pushing one pulling to reduce my noise but keep my temps about the same...

Will it work or am I smoking crack?

neither is better, necessarilly. both create dead spots if placed directly on the HC, because of the hub in the fan where the blades are connected. A shroud is needed on both sides (push AND pull) or you will have a spot on your HC that is warmer than the rest, thus reducing overall cooling.

It's probably a 12V fan, you could also probably rewire it at 7V. For example, rewiring a Delta fan will bring it from around 130cfm to 80cfm, and noise is down from 46db to 33db. Would save you having to buy an extra fan.
